Changeset 235


Ignore:
Timestamp:
10/24/13 21:06:26 (6 years ago)
Author:
nhoyt
Message:

Fixing layout inconsistencies between Mac OS X and Windows 7

summary-rc.xul, summary-wcag.xul

  • added columns element and column flex attributes
  • deleted spacer element to the right of grid

view-details.xul

  • first tabpanel: added id and deleted width attribute

ai-sidebar.css

  • removed border from tabpanel that contains element results tree to eliminate duplicate
  • removed hard-coded width properties on tbl-summary-label and tbl-summary-name
  • added -moz-box-flex property to summary table grids and element results tree
Location:
trunk/proto-14/chrome
Files:
4 edited

Legend:

Unmodified
Added
Removed
  • trunk/proto-14/chrome/content/summary-rc.xul

    r201 r235  
    99    <hbox> 
    1010      <grid> 
     11        <columns> 
     12          <column/> 
     13          <column flex="1"/> 
     14          <column flex="1"/> 
     15          <column flex="1"/> 
     16          <column flex="1"/> 
     17        </columns> 
    1118        <rows> 
    1219          <row class="tbl-summary-header"> 
     
    107114        </rows> 
    108115      </grid> 
    109       <spacer flex="4"/> 
    110116    </hbox> 
    111117  </vbox> 
  • trunk/proto-14/chrome/content/summary-wcag.xul

    r201 r235  
    99    <hbox> 
    1010      <grid> 
     11        <columns> 
     12          <column/> 
     13          <column flex="1"/> 
     14          <column flex="1"/> 
     15          <column flex="1"/> 
     16          <column flex="1"/> 
     17        </columns> 
    1118        <rows> 
    1219          <row class="tbl-summary-header"> 
     
    113120        </rows> 
    114121      </grid> 
    115       <spacer flex="4"/> 
    116122    </hbox> 
    117123  </vbox> 
  • trunk/proto-14/chrome/content/view-details.xul

    r227 r235  
    3030      </tabs> 
    3131      <tabpanels style="padding: 16px 0px 0px"> 
    32         <tabpanel height="251" style="background: white"> 
    33           <tree id="ainspector-element-results-tree" width="381" 
     32        <tabpanel id="ainspector-element-results-panel" 
     33          height="251" style="background: white"> 
     34          <tree id="ainspector-element-results-tree" 
    3435            rows="12" seltype="single" style="margin: 0" 
    3536            persist="sortDirection sortResource" 
  • trunk/proto-14/chrome/skin/ai-sidebar.css

    r227 r235  
    8484 
    8585label.tbl-summary-label { 
    86   width: 43px; 
    8786  min-width: 43px; 
    8887  padding: 2px; 
     
    9089 
    9190label.tbl-summary-name { 
    92   width: 148px; 
    9391  min-width: 148px; 
    9492  text-align: left; 
     
    116114  border-bottom: 1px solid #bbb; 
    117115  border-left: 1px solid #bbb; 
     116} 
     117 
     118tabpanel#ainspector-element-results-panel { 
     119  border: 0; 
    118120} 
    119121 
     
    163165  padding: 4px; 
    164166} 
     167 
     168vbox#ainspector-category-summary, vbox#ainspector-guideline-summary { 
     169  -moz-box-flex: 1; 
     170} 
     171 
     172tree#ainspector-element-results-tree { 
     173  -moz-box-flex: 1; 
     174} 
Note: See TracChangeset for help on using the changeset viewer.